4koma manga like Azumanga Daioh (or K-On, or Lucky Star) are a completely different beast from regular manga as far as anime adaptations go : you get way more dialogue (and stuff happening) per page, on average. So it's relatively easy to extract more episodes per volume (especially if you add exposition shots and bridging sequences between the jokes).
